    Some extra information here - There are dies available for this. I have the die for my Accuquilt Studio. But, it is also available for the Accuquilt Go. Don't know if there is one for the Accuquilt Baby Go. I especially like this die for kaleidoscopes utilizing repeats of fabric. Much easier than cutting with rotary cutter - and very accurate!
